AI Tools for Technical Chatbots: Enhancing Support and Automation
In today’s digital era, businesses rely on AI-powered chatbots to streamline customer interactions, provide technical support, and automate routine tasks. Technical chatbots are no longer limited to answering basic queries; they now offer advanced features like troubleshooting, integration with IT systems, and predictive analytics. In this article, we’ll explore the best AI tools for building and managing technical chatbots, how they work, and why they are essential for modern businesses.
Why Use AI Tools for Technical Chatbots?
Traditional rule-based bots often fail when handling complex or unexpected user queries. On the other hand, AI-driven chatbots use natural language processing (NLP) and machine learning to understand context, provide accurate answers, and even learn from past interactions. By using AI tools, businesses can:
- Deliver 24/7 technical support to customers and employees.
- Automate repetitive IT tasks such as password resets or system status checks.
- Provide faster and more accurate troubleshooting guidance.
- Integrate with existing enterprise tools and platforms.
- Improve customer satisfaction while reducing operational costs.
Top AI Tools for Technical Chatbots
1. Dialogflow (by Google Cloud)
Dialogflow is one of the most popular AI chatbot platforms that supports voice and text-based conversations. It provides advanced NLP capabilities, multilingual support, and integration with popular platforms like Slack, Messenger, and custom enterprise systems. For technical chatbots, Dialogflow enables automated workflows, intent recognition, and contextual responses, making it ideal for IT helpdesks and customer support teams.
2. Microsoft Bot Framework
The Microsoft Bot Framework allows developers to build enterprise-grade chatbots with seamless integration into Microsoft Teams, Azure Cognitive Services, and other Microsoft 365 tools. It’s particularly strong for organizations already using Microsoft’s ecosystem, offering powerful AI models, natural language understanding, and custom deployment options for technical support environments.
3. IBM Watson Assistant
IBM Watson Assistant is designed to deliver intelligent, context-aware chatbot experiences. It supports deep integration with enterprise IT systems, making it highly effective for technical chatbots handling complex workflows. With Watson Assistant, businesses can build bots capable of diagnosing issues, recommending solutions, and escalating tickets to human agents when needed.
4. Rasa (Open Source)
Rasa is an open-source framework for building conversational AI applications. Unlike SaaS platforms, Rasa offers full customization and on-premise deployment, which is crucial for companies that need data privacy and advanced control. It’s widely used for developing technical support chatbots in industries where compliance and security are priorities.
5. Drift
Drift is primarily a conversational marketing platform, but it also offers AI-driven chatbot capabilities that can be adapted for technical support. It’s best suited for companies that want to combine customer engagement with support automation. Drift provides real-time conversation routing, integration with CRM systems, and proactive issue resolution features.
Benefits of Using AI-Powered Technical Chatbots
- Cost Efficiency: Reduce the need for large support teams while ensuring round-the-clock availability.
- Scalability: Handle thousands of customer interactions simultaneously without performance drops.
- Consistency: Provide accurate and standardized responses across all customer touchpoints.
- Data Insights: Analyze user queries to identify recurring issues and improve services.
How to Choose the Right AI Tool for Your Technical Chatbot
When selecting the best AI tool for your technical chatbot, consider the following factors:
- Integration: Does the tool integrate with your existing IT infrastructure and platforms?
- Customization: Can you tailor workflows, intents, and responses to your business needs?
- Scalability: Will it handle growth as your customer base and support requests increase?
- Security: Does it offer compliance and data privacy options for sensitive information?
- Cost: Does the pricing model align with your business goals?
Frequently Asked Questions (FAQ)
What is a technical chatbot?
A technical chatbot is an AI-powered virtual assistant designed to provide IT support, troubleshoot problems, and automate technical workflows for both customers and employees.
Can AI chatbots replace human agents?
AI chatbots can handle repetitive and simple tasks efficiently, but human agents are still essential for complex cases that require empathy, judgment, or advanced problem-solving.
Which is better: cloud-based or on-premise chatbot platforms?
Cloud-based platforms (like Dialogflow or Watson Assistant) offer quick deployment and scalability, while open-source on-premise platforms (like Rasa) provide more control, security, and customization. The choice depends on your organization’s needs.
Do AI chatbots require coding?
Some platforms like Dialogflow and Watson offer low-code or no-code solutions, making them accessible to non-technical users. However, frameworks like Rasa may require programming skills for full customization.
How much does it cost to implement a technical chatbot?
Costs vary depending on the platform, level of customization, and deployment scale. Some tools offer free tiers, while enterprise solutions can cost thousands of dollars per month.
Conclusion
AI tools for technical chatbots are transforming the way businesses deliver IT support and customer service. Whether you’re looking for enterprise-grade solutions like Microsoft Bot Framework or flexible open-source platforms like Rasa, there’s a tool to fit every need. By investing in the right chatbot technology, companies can reduce costs, improve customer satisfaction, and stay ahead in the digital era.

